Personal Life

Among Sarah Hertz's spouses was Samuel Hermann Samuelson[3]. Children include Edward Samuelson[4]; Martin Samuelson[5], 1825–1903[17]; James Samuelson[6]; Newton Samuelson[7]; Alexander Samuelson[8], an engineer[18], 1826–1873[19]; and Bernhard Samuelson[9], a politician[20], 1820–1905[21], of United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land[22], awarded the Fellow of the Royal Society[23].
